How to treat a maid in Colombia

Ok, don’t be misled, this is not a thesis on the subject; simply a story I thought you might find interesting.

Martha dropped by for a quick visit as she so often does – but this time she broke down in tears. Martha is a maid where we live and her master had just died after her 35 years of service. She was deeply affected by his decease, as was his dog that followed Martha everywhere. Oh dear I thought, what is to become of her, she is already at the age of retirement and she never married, nor had any children. I think I was right to fear the worst as my 17 years in Colombia has shown me how maids can be taken advantage of. Ten minutes later my fears were set aside as she told us what was to become of her.

Martha’s 35 years of full-time service had seen her assist in raising the master’s three children and then carry the household burden after his wife had died. Whilst so many maids do the same with little or no protection and security, Martha had been fortunate her master had fulfilled all the legal obligations regarding health and pension insurances. This was already a step up on what most maids obtain, but Martha was about to astounded by the manner in which she had been considered by “her family”.

The three children, now adults with their own children and families, had got together to ensure Martha would be properly provided for. The master’s house has been put up for sale, but they have already put aside enough money to immediately acquire a three bedroom apartment in La Ceja, a town just outside Medellin. Now, for the first time in her life, she owns her own property. Not only this, she has first call on any of the furniture in her master’s home and his children accompanied her on a shopping trip to “personalise” her new home.

Now you know why I thought this story interesting – you do not hear actions like this too often. On the contrary, I feel we often need some form of masochist armour to suffer today’s media headlines (Does bad news sell better than good news?).

Not only this, but queries regarding how to treat maids comes up frequently on this forum and I am disappointed to see how many expats’ main concern is how to avoid legal obligations and reduce costs.
